RIOS-1 (RISC Instruction Organization System-1) is one of the most important processor designs in the history of enterprise computing. Developed by IBM in the late 1980s, RIOS-1 became the first implementation of the POWER1 architecture and introduced several advanced concepts that would later influence modern CPU design.
As organizations demanded faster computing performance for engineering, scientific, and business applications, IBM responded with a groundbreaking processor architecture that delivered unprecedented processing power. Today, RIOS-1 remains a significant milestone in the evolution of RISC (Reduced Instruction Set Computing) technology.
RIOS-1
What Is RIOS-1?
RIOS-1 is a multi-chip processor implementation developed by IBM as the original version of the POWER1 processor family. Unlike modern CPUs that integrate all components onto a single chip, RIOS-1 used a sophisticated multi-chip design that separated various processing functions across multiple dedicated chips.
This architecture enabled IBM to achieve high performance levels that were difficult to attain with the semiconductor technology available at the time. The processor became the foundation of IBM's RS/6000 workstation and server systems, helping establish IBM as a leader in high-performance computing.
Key Features of RIOS-1
Advanced Multi-Chip Architecture
One of the defining characteristics of RIOS-1 was its multi-chip configuration. The processor included specialized chips dedicated to instruction caching, floating-point operations, fixed-point processing, data caching, storage control, and input/output management.
This modular approach allowed IBM engineers to optimize each component independently, resulting in improved overall system performance.
Early Out-of-Order Execution
RIOS-1 is recognized as one of the first processor architectures to implement out-of-order execution. This technology allows instructions to be processed as resources become available rather than strictly following their original sequence.
The innovation significantly improved CPU efficiency and became a standard feature in modern high-performance processors.
Register Renaming Technology
Another breakthrough introduced by the POWER1 architecture through RIOS-1 was register renaming. This technique reduces data dependency conflicts and increases instruction-level parallelism, enabling faster execution of complex workloads.
Today, register renaming remains a core feature in modern processors from leading manufacturers worldwide.
Why RIOS-1 Was Important
The introduction of RIOS-1 represented a major advancement in processor design. It demonstrated that RISC architectures could compete with and outperform traditional CISC systems in demanding enterprise environments.
Key benefits included:
Higher computational efficiency
Improved floating-point performance
Better scalability for engineering and scientific applications
Enhanced support for workstation and server workloads
Foundation for future IBM POWER processors
The success of RIOS-1 helped shape IBM's long-term processor roadmap and influenced the development of future POWER generations.
RIOS-1 and the Evolution of POWER Processors
RIOS-1 was the starting point for a family of processors that would evolve into one of the most respected enterprise computing architectures in the world.
Following RIOS-1, IBM introduced:
RIOS.9
POWER1+
POWER1++
RISC Single Chip (RSC)
RAD6000 for aerospace and space applications
These successors expanded the capabilities of the original design while maintaining the performance-focused philosophy that made RIOS-1 successful.
Impact on Modern Computing
Many concepts pioneered or popularized by RIOS-1 are now standard in modern processor design. Features such as out-of-order execution, advanced caching systems, and instruction-level parallelism continue to power today's CPUs used in servers, workstations, cloud infrastructure, and artificial intelligence systems.
The processor's influence extends beyond IBM products, as many of its architectural innovations inspired developments across the semiconductor industry.
RIOS-1 in Historical Perspective
When examining the history of computing, RIOS-1 stands out as a transformative technology that bridged the gap between early RISC experimentation and modern high-performance processor architectures.
Its innovative design proved that advanced architectural techniques could dramatically improve performance and efficiency. As a result, RIOS-1 earned a place among the most influential processor implementations ever created.
Conclusion
RIOS-1 was more than just a processor—it was a technological breakthrough that helped define the future of enterprise computing. By introducing advanced concepts such as register renaming and out-of-order execution, IBM established a foundation that continues to influence processor development today.
For technology enthusiasts, historians, and IT professionals, understanding RIOS-1 provides valuable insight into how modern computing evolved and why IBM's POWER architecture remains relevant decades later.
MORE:
Frequently Asked Questions RIOS-1
What does RIOS-1 stand for?
RIOS-1 stands for RISC Instruction Organization System-1 and represents the original implementation of IBM's POWER1 architecture.
Why was RIOS-1 significant?
It introduced advanced CPU technologies such as register renaming and out-of-order execution, which are widely used in modern processors.
Was RIOS-1 a single-chip processor?
No. RIOS-1 used a multi-chip architecture with specialized chips handling different processing functions.
What systems used RIOS-1?
The processor was primarily deployed in IBM RS/6000 workstations and servers.
Did RIOS-1 influence modern CPUs?
Yes. Many architectural innovations associated with RIOS-1 became industry standards and continue to be used in contemporary processor designs.
Historical records show that RIOS-1 was the original 10-chip implementation of IBM's POWER1 processor family and was among the earliest processors to employ both register renaming and out-of-order execution techniques.